GM-1M Grouting & Mixing Plant
Specifications:
- 1–1.5 m³/h maximum mixing capacity (with water/cement ratio = 1:1)
- Mixing tank capacity: 150 litres (Turbo mix pump, open impeller type, 700 l/min max. delivery @ 1 Bar, hydraulically driven)
- Includes bag breaker and hopper mounted on the side of the mixing tank
- Max flow rate 100 l/min, max pressure 12.0 bar
- Sound abated hydraulic power pack – DIESEL 17 kW
- Approximate weight: 1,300 kg
